ElementUI 按需加载
前言
1.对项目进行构建
npm run build
2. 按需加载,需要安装一个插件 babel-plugin-component
npm install babel-plugin-component - D
修改babel.config.js
module.exports = {
presets: [
'@vue/cli-plugin-babel/preset'
],
plugins: [
[
'component', {
'libraryName':'element-ui',
'styleLibraryName':'theme-chalk'
}
]
]
}
3.修改main.js
import {Button,Message} from 'element-ui'
Vue.component(Button.name,Button)
Vue.prototype.$message = Message
4重新对项目打包
npm run build
这样按需加载配置就好了
https://element.eleme.cn/#/zh-CN/component/button